Fleas are a common external parasite that feed off your cat'southward blood. Although they tin create some health concerns, itchiness and allergic reactions on your cat's skin is a mutual symptom. Some fleas even carry certain species of tapeworms, which make your cat susceptible to contracting parasitic infections.

The skillful news is there are many bachelor products that can help protect your true cat from getting new flea infections, besides as treat whatsoever pre-existing infections.

What types of flea treatments are available?

Oral products usually come up in pill or tablet form. These items, such every bit Capstar, tend to be used for rapidly treating existing infections.

Topical formulations are the most pop and easiest prescription flea treatment. They commonly come equally a liquid in a vial. The liquid formulation is applied to the skin on the dorsum of your true cat'due south cervix. These products are typically given once a month and are ideal for both treating existing infections and preventing new ones from developing.

Topical formulations sometimes include prevention for other parasites, such as mites. A How-do-you-do Ralphie veterinarian can help consult on which products, such as Advantage or Revolution, are best for your true cat'southward needs.

Alternatively, a flea neckband or a flea bath tin can care for and prevent fleas, although nearly collars and flea shampoos don't work as finer and have high risks to your true cat.

How long later on flea treatment can I pet my cat?

You lot tin usually cuddle and pet your cat immediately later receiving an oral flea prevention medication. Topical products can have a few hours to soak into the skin layer.

Avert petting your cat for 24-48 hours in the spot where you applied a topical medication. These treatments aren't harmful for humans, just it'southward important that equally trivial as possible is removed from the cat and soaked through human being peel.

Additionally, your true cat should remain dry out for at least 24 hours after a topical flea medication has been practical. Avert applying the treatment if your cat goes exterior in snowy or rainy conditions. Alternatively, go along your cat inside for 24 hours after applying the medicine to his or her pare

Should I worry most Fleas?

Fleas don't generally like to live on humans, but they tin occasionally bite. Flea bites tend to occur around the ankles and feet. Contact your family medico if you suspect you have flea bites.

How often should I apply flea prevention?

Information technology depends on which formulation you decide to utilize for your true cat. Most oral medications are used every 1-3 months that can vary by make. The standard time frame for applying topical medications is usually every xxx days, but this tin depend on the make used.

Climate and lifestyle play a large part in determining how often you should use a flea prevention or flea handling. Warm and humid climates tend to have a higher take chances of fleas. In general, most cats should exist on flea prevention year round.

If your cat oft goes outside, interacts with other cats, or hunts rodents, they may be at risk of communicable fleas more than than indoor cats, although indoor merely cats are even so at risk. Is at that place anything else I can do to protect my cat confronting fleas?

Make sure every animal in your household has been treated for fleas. If one pet has an infection, it's likely the others volition contract one, too.

Fleas can jump off their hosts and lay eggs in areas around your dwelling, such equally carpets and inside forest flooring. These flea eggs can lay dormant for a while earlier they hatch into flea larvae and develop into adults, which can hop back onto your cat.

If your pet has had fleas, diligently clean and disinfect the house after the initial flea treatment. Make sure whatever bedding is washed, couches and carpets are vacuumed, and floors are disinfected.

Depending on which flea treatment or prevention product y'all select, your cat may need a few doses to make sure no new infections arise from leftover fleas. You can also consider deworming your feline friend. Fleas can besides pass along tapeworm eggs that may cause tapeworm infection in your cat if they accidentally swallow the fleas. Read more than virtually cats and worms hither.
